Methodology: Analyzing Traffic Metrics
To quantify the impact of sponsored posts on traffic, it's crucial to analyze specific metrics. Here are some key indicators:
- Page Views: Track how many times each sponsored post is viewed.
- Engagement Rate: Monitor likes, comments, and shares to gauge audience interest.
- Conversion Rate: Assess if there's an increase in sign-ups or other desired actions following the post.
By closely monitoring these metrics, you can determine whether sponsored posts are driving traffic to your website.
